Hello my name is Sandra and I’m currently trying to help Sophie and orange rare female cat who was left behind by its previous owner. She has always been an outside cat who I have been feeding for the past few months. She is the sweetest cat she is people friendly and a few days ago I noticed she looked sick and decided to bring her to my home to keep her out of the cold and seek help to take her to a vet. I made a post on social media to try to get help from a rescue but unfortunately everybody is full at the moment I still have not lost hope she will soon find one and find her forever home. This past Saturday I was able to take her to Amazing small animal practice to have her seen by a vet and per the owner of that establishment Sophie is way to skinny and noticed that her gums are very swollen and she thinks she needs her back teeth extracted but recommended to get blood work and X-rays done so we can know what we are dealing with. The owner was kind enough to give her a 2 week antibiotic and some flea medication and she seems better. She still needs to get blood work and x rays but unfortunately finances are very tight for me and I’m seeking help to be able to get Sophie seen by a different vet.

update: Sophie has been seen by a different vet who was able to do blood work her results show a very high number for infection and inflammation per vet he feels comfortable in sedating her to perform a dental cleaning and removing teeth unfortunately I’m not able to pay at this time and I’m asking for any donations to be able to get Sophie the procedure she needs and getting her healthy again! Thank you!

Update: As of now Sophie was seen by a different vet who was able to remove all her upper back teeth and bottom back teeth. This has help her alot specially in gaining weight as when I first got her she was skin and bones. It has been closed to two months that she has been recuperating but I believe she would benefit in removing remainder teeth that are left as she still has some inflammation and the best course of action with stomatitis is to
have them all removed.
